Miss America 2015 – The Sorority Women Who Competed in 2014

Congratulations to Kira Kazantsev, Miss America  2015! She is not a current member of a sorority. 

After Kira Kazantsev was crowned Miss America, the first runner up of the Miss New York competition became Miss New York. She is Jillian Tapper, Alpha Delta Pi from Florida State University.

On September 14, 2014, Miss America 2014, Nina Davuluri, Sigma Kappa, will crown her successor. These women belong to National Panhellenic Conference (NPC) or National Pan-Hellenic Council (NPHC) sororities. I’ll be live blogging the pageant, so please check back.

Sorority women who are competing for the Miss America 2015 crown are:

Miss Alabama – Caitlin Brunell, Phi Mu, University of Alabama* Quality of Life Scholarship Award for Community Service

Miss Alaska – Malie Delgado, Alpha Sigma Alpha, University of Alaska, Anchorage

Miss Arkansas – Ashton Campbell, Chi Omega, University of Arkansas

Miss California – Marina Inserra, Delta Zeta, San Diego State University

Miss Delaware – Brittany Lewis, Alpha Kappa Alpha, Temple University 1st Runner Up Quality of Life Scholarship Award for Community Service

Miss District of Columbia – Teresa Davis, Kappa Alpha Theta, University of Georgia

Miss Florida – Victoria Cowen, Kappa Delta, Florida State University** Preliminary Lifestyle Fitness Award Winner

Miss Georgia – Maggie Bridges, Alpha Delta Pi, Georgia Institute of Technology, $5,000 STEM Scholarship

Miss Kansas – Amanda Sasek, Alpha Sigma Alpha, University of Central Missouri.

Miss Louisiana – Lacey Sanchez, Phi Mu, Southeastern Louisiana/Louisiana State 

Miss Maryland – Jade Kenny, Alpha Delta Pi, University of Alabama 2nd Runner Up Quality of Life Scholarship Award for Community Service, Preliminary Lifestyle/Fitness Award Winner

Miss Nebraska – Megan Swanson, Alpha Sigma Tau, Belmont University

Miss Pennsylvania – Amanda Smith, Alpha Delta Pi, Florida State University Preliminary Talent Award Winner

Miss Rhode Island – Ivy Depew, Delta Gamma, University of Memphis

Miss South Carolina – Lanie Hudson, Alpha Delta Pi, Clemson University

Miss Tennessee – Hayley Lewis, Phi Mu, Belmont University

Miss Texas  Monique Evans, Alpha Delta Pi, University of Texas

Miss Vermont – Lucy Edwards, Delta Delta Delta, University of Vermont, $5,000 STEM Scholarship

Miss Washington – Kailee Dunn, Gamma Phi Beta, Eastern Washington University

*Caitlin’s grandmother, Sherrie Pendley Liebsack, is a Pi Phi and she serves as a Pi Beta Phi Foundation Ambassador. And I just found out that Caitlin’s mom is a Pi Phi, too!
 
** Miss Florida Elizabeth Fentchel, Alpha Delta Pi, University of Florida was disqualified after she had been named the winner.
